The Italy drip irrigation market is witnessing steady growth driven by factors such as increasing water scarcity, growing adoption of sustainable agricultural practices, and government support for efficient water management in agriculture. Drip irrigation systems are gaining popularity among Italian farmers due to their ability to deliver water and nutrients directly to the roots of plants, leading to higher crop yields and water efficiency. The market is characterized by the presence of both domestic and international players offering a wide range of drip irrigation products and services. Technological advancements, such as the integration of automation and digitalization in drip irrigation systems, are further contributing to market growth. Overall, the Italy drip irrigation market is poised for expansion as farmers seek innovative solutions to optimize water usage and improve agricultural productivity.

In the Italy Drip Irrigation Market, some key challenges include the high initial investment required for setting up drip irrigation systems, which can be a barrier for small-scale farmers. Additionally, there is a lack of awareness and education among farmers about the benefits and proper use of drip irrigation technology. Water scarcity and regulatory issues related to water usage also pose challenges for the adoption of drip irrigation in Italy. Furthermore, the fragmented nature of the agricultural sector in Italy can make it difficult for drip irrigation companies to reach a wide customer base efficiently. Overcoming these challenges would require targeted education and training programs, government support in terms of subsidies or incentives, as well as innovative solutions to make drip irrigation more affordable and accessible to a larger number of farmers in Italy.

In Italy, government policies related to the drip irrigation market aim to promote sustainable water use in agriculture. The government provides incentives and subsidies to encourage farmers to adopt drip irrigation systems, which help conserve water and improve crop yield. Additionally, there are regulations in place to ensure efficient water management practices, such as restricting water usage during droughts and promoting the use of water-saving technologies. The government also supports research and development efforts in the drip irrigation sector to enhance innovation and technological advancements. Overall, Italy`s government policies prioritize the sustainable use of water resources in agriculture through the promotion of drip irrigation technologies and practices.
